Enter Zen Mode
- 1.Open an editable existing note or Keep's inline new-note composer.
- 2.Choose Zen mode above the detected note.
- 3.Continue writing in Keep's original title, body, checklist, and media controls.
2
What changes while focused
- Keep's header, sidebar, background feed, metadata, labels, and auxiliary actions are hidden temporarily.
- The note expands into a centered canvas that follows the note's rendered light or dark colors.
- Existing focus and scrolling remain available inside the native editor.
3
Exit without closing the note
Choose Exit Zen or press Escape once. The normal Keep interface returns and the note remains open. Closing or replacing the note, navigating, reloading, or stopping the extension also clears Zen Mode.
Important boundaries
- Zen Mode works only while an editable native Keep note is open.
- Its state is not saved or carried to another note, tab, or browser session.
- It changes presentation only and does not serialize, clone, or save note content itself.
